Cron作业跳过运行(App Engine标准环境)

时间:2018-09-29 08:34:53

标签: google-app-engine cron

我有以下cron.yaml定义:

cron:
- description: "Run Update"
  url: /doUpdate
  schedule: every 3 hours from 00:31 to 22:32
  timezone: America/New_York
  X-Appengine-Cron: true

当我检查过去一天的运行时,我看到:

2018-09-28 09:31:00.360 EDT GET 200 184 B 378 ms AppEngine-Google; (+http://code.google.com/appengine) /doUpdate
2018-09-28 12:31:00.802 EDT GET 200 184 B 450 ms AppEngine-Google; (+http://code.google.com/appengine) /doUpdate
2018-09-28 15:31:00.357 EDT GET 200 184 B 629 ms AppEngine-Google; (+http://code.google.com/appengine) /doUpdate
2018-09-28 18:31:01.091 EDT GET 200 158 B 588 ms AppEngine-Google; (+http://code.google.com/appengine) /doUpdate

现在凌晨4点,最后一次运行是在昨天下午6点。昨天21:31或今天早上00:31的执行似乎都没有执行。

我的日程安排有问题吗?

0 个答案:

没有答案